Original Description
Philip Jacques de Loutherbourg’s A Village Landscape With A Mule Leading Cattle, A Mother And Child At A Well encapsulates a serene yet dynamic rural vignette of late 18th-century European pastoral life. Bathed in soft golden light, the scene unfolds with meticulous detail—a sturdy mule leads cattle along a dusty path while a mother tenderly interacts with her child by a well, evoking warmth and timeless simplicity. Painted circa 1790–1800, this work reflects Loutherbourg’s mastery as a Franco-British Romantic artist, blending realism with atmospheric depth. A pioneer of theatrical set design, he infused landscapes with dramatic luminosity, bridging the grandeur of Claude Lorrain and the nascent English Romantic movement. Though lesser-known than contemporaries like Turner, his compositions influenced the picturesque tradition, making this piece a subtle gem within art history—ideal for admirers of bucolic harmony and historical narrative.
